Azerbaijan, Baku, Sept. 15 / Trend , S.Aliyev/

The cost of Stage-2 of the project on development of the Azerbaijani Shah Deniz gas field is estimated at $20-22 billion, said Rovnag Abdullayev, the head of the State Oil Company of Azerbaijan Republic (SOCAR). SOCAR 's share in the project is 10 percent.

At present the relevant parties are discussing various versions to produce gas in State-2 of the development of Shah Deniz. One of the priorities is the production from submarine wells of great depth, the source said.

It is planned to launch the second stage in 2014, just under the second phase, it is planned to produce annually up to 20 billion cubic meters of gas.

The contract on development of off-shore Shah Deniz field was signed on 4 June 1996. Shah Deniz participating interests are: ВР (operator - 25.5 percent), StatoilHydro (25.5 percent), SOCAR (10 percent), LukAgip (10 percent), NICO (10 percent), Total (10 percent), and TPAO (9 percent).
